Need advice for SAP installation on External  Hard disk

Hi Gurus,
I have HP laptop with configuration of 512 MB RAM and 50 GB hard disk...i recently bought 250 GB segate external  hard disk for SAP installation...My doubt here is if i  install SAP in external hard disk and will it work properly if i connect my laptop?
ur advice is much appreciated
Regards
Dinesh

Hi Dinesh,
I have installed SAP on external harddisk.
And it will work properly.
But i think you need to increase your RAM.
After installation, please keep in mind one thing.
You will have to attach your external harddisk before your machine starts, because your OS will be in internal harddisk, so SAP and oracel services won't be able to run without external hard-disk.
and in case you attach after system startup, please start all services.

  • Itunes for window on an external hard disk

    I have my itunes library on an external hard disk and it is working fine but I am about to get a new computer. What is the easiset way to get my new installation of itunes to view the library on the external hard disk.
    If anybody knows the answer can they please reply to this, thanks.
      Windows XP Pro  

    - Save the following files from the old PC:
    -- 1) The Library database file: ‘iTunes Library.itl’ located in the ‘iTunes’ folder
    -- 2) The Library XML file: ‘iTunes Music Library.xml’ located in the ‘iTunes’ folder
    - Copy these files to your new PC somewhere safe
    - Install iTunes on the new PC
    - Configure your ExHD to attach to the new PC as the same drive letter as on the old PC
    - Attach the ExHD to the new PC
    - Copy the two saved database files (XML & ITL) into the 'My Music\iTunes' folder of the new PC - replace the smaller, new files that are there
    - Open iTunes
    Your new PC's Library should be a clone of the old PC's. These are high-level instructions. If you feel you need more, post back.

  • Importing songs from an external Hard Disk

    As I am using a laptop, with a small amount of hard disk space and due to my excessive amount ofmusic I wish to hold my music on a external hard disk (there for is not anywhere on the c:). However when I tried to import this music into my i-tunes libary previously the itunes program could not find the information for any of my external hard disks. I was hoping someone could help me, as I cannot store all that music on a 50bd hard disk with all my other data.
    This is info on the Hard Disk it may help:
    Make: Lacie
    Connection: USB 2.0
    Plug and Play: No, drivers have to be installed off the lacie disk that came with that product.
    ANy help would be appreciated so much!!!

    OK just so were clear, theres 2 features in iTunes. One is File>Import which will COPY the song from its current location (Be it on an external drive or CD) to the "iTunes Music" folder on the C drive by default.
    The Other feature is File>Add File (Or Folder) to Library which does not move or copy the song, it just "Points" iTunes to where the song(s) are located on the system. If you don't want these files on your laptops harddrive, you need to use this.
    Now anything you buy on the iTunes Music Store are, by default put in
    C;//........My Music/iTUnes/iTUnes Music folder
    If you buy things from the store on this laptop, you may want to go thru iTUnes (Not Windows Explorer) to move this folder to the external. Goto Edit>preferences>advanced tab>General Sub Tab and here is where you can change the location of this file tothe external by hitting the "Change" button

  • HT202796 I can not copy, modify, any file from my Mac to external hard disk,  of the seagate brand (fast HDD Portable Drive)  I don´t know  if I need some software to copy and  modify files in my hard disk external ? Could you help me please?

    Hello I have a iMac with 3.4 GHZ intel core I7, memory 16 GB 1333 MHZ DDR3, and OS X 10.9.4 Software.
    I have problems when I try to copy or modify any file from my MAC to MY PORTABLE DRIVE/DISQUE (external hard disk).
    my external hard disk have the next features:
    brand: Seagate
    4TB
    I do not know if I need some software such as: paragon or I need to configure my MAC,
    Please help me..
    Thanks a lot

    Click on it, choose Get Info from the File menu, and check the format.
    If it's formatted as NTFS, reformat it as MS-DOS, exFAT, or Mac OS Extended (Journaled) as desired, or install software such as Paragon NTFS on the computer.
    If it's formatted as FAT32 or exFAT, use the Disk Utility's Repair Disk command on it; this may also happen for a flash drive which is about to fail.
    If it's formatted as Mac OS Extended, click Authenticate and provide your administrator password, or change the permissions on that specific folder in its Get Info window.

  • Instructions For Moving To An External Hard Drive - Mac

    I have a Macbook where I use Lightroom. However, my internal drive is filling up and I would like to get instructions on how have the library reside on my new 250gb external drive. Thanks!!

    In Lightroom, the catalog database is separate from the image files. To move to an external hard disk, you need to move both. The easiest way is to simply drag over the folder that the catalog file resides in (so you also copy over the previews) and also drag over the folders that contain the image files. Now delete both from the original location if you're sure everything moved over correctly and double-click on the copied-over lrcat file. If your images are in the same relative location to the catalog file as on the original harddisk, it will find the image files by itself. If they are not in the same relative location, Lightroom will make the enclosing folder name red in the Library pane. Simply right (or control on a mac with a single button mouse) on the red and show it the new folder location.
    One good tip for lightroom users is to really be aware of where Lightroom imports images to in the import dialog. You'll see that even after you've moved over the images and catalog, Lightroom will want to import new files to the old location on your internal hard disk, so you need to tell it where to import. After the first time you do that it will usually remember.

  • External hard disk for Time Machine

    I'm considering baking up my iMac. I have a Lacie external hard disk with a Master Boot Record partition type. On it, there are already some data files from both Windows and Mac machines.
    I understand that, for Time Machine to work, the partition type needs to be changed to GUID (for Intel based Mac). Obviously, I will need to copy these data files to somewhere, then use Disk Utility to change the partition type, partition the hard disk (one partition to be used for Time Machine back-up).
    My question is, will it be safe to copy the data files (previously from Windows and Mac machines) back to another partition of the hard disk which will then has a GUID partition type? Will the files (including those from Windows machines) be usable?

    KenWong wrote:
    I'm considering baking up my iMac. I have a Lacie external hard disk with a Master Boot Record partition type. On it, there are already some data files from both Windows and Mac machines.
    I understand that, for Time Machine to work, the partition type needs to be changed to GUID (for Intel based Mac). Obviously, I will need to copy these data files to somewhere, then use Disk Utility to change the partition type, partition the hard disk (one partition to be used for Time Machine back-up).
    My question is, will it be safe to copy the data files (previously from Windows and Mac machines) back to another partition of the hard disk which will then has a GUID partition type? Will the files (including those from Windows machines) be usable?
    You're slightly mixing terminology.
    The *+Partition Map Scheme+* applies to the whole disk, whether it has one or multiple partitions. That's what needs to be GUID or +Apple Partition Map+.
    The Format applies to each partition, and may be different for each one. Your TM partition needs to be +Mac OS Extended (Journaled),+ the other one can be +MS-DOS (FAT)+ for use with Windoze.
    You can copy those files anywhere temporarily, while re-formattng the disk. It doesn't have to be a separate partition. It could even be CDs/DVDs. As long as you can copy and read back, it doesn't matter. If you put them on your boot drive, Windoze won't be able to read them while they're there, but once you get them back on a +MS-DOS (FAT)+ partition, it will.
    See the instructions in item #5 of the Frequently Asked Questions *User Tip* at the top of this forum.
    We usually recommend putting the Time Machine partition first (at the top of the diagram that Disk Utility will show you), so you can more easily expand or contract it later on, if you need to.
